Bug description:
grub fails to work when araid1 lvm volume exists that is cached in zesty.
grub version 2.02~beta3-4ubuntu1
The same configuration worked on yakkety
~$ sudo update-grub2
Generating grub configuration file ...
Found linux image: /boot/vmlinuz-4.10.0-14-generic
Found initrd image: /boot/initrd.img-4.10.0-14-generic
Found linux image: /boot/vmlinuz-4.8.0-45-generic
Found initrd image: /boot/initrd.img-4.8.0-45-generic
Found memtest86+ image: /memtest86+.elf
Found memtest86+ image: /memtest86+.bin
Found Windows 7 on /dev/sdc4
Found Debian GNU/Linux wheezy/sid on /dev/mapper/lvm-debian
Found Ubuntu 15.04 (15.04) on /dev/mapper/lvm-root2
Found Ubuntu 14.04.1 LTS (14.04) on /dev/mapper/lvm-root3
$ sudo lvcreate --type raid1 -L 1G lvm -n testing
Logical volume "testing" created.
~$ sudo lvcreate --type cache --cachemode writeback -L 10G -n ssdcachetest lvm/testing /dev/sda1
Using default stripesize 64.00 KiB.
WARNING: Data redundancy is lost with writeback caching of raid logical volume!
Logical volume lvm/testing is now cached.
~$ sudo update-grub2
Generating grub configuration file ...

grub-probe: error: disk `lvmid/OwVp3J-KH9N-RcXl-Fh3J-ZEiZ-egg4-JRffI3/7Dieap-dj1i-dHiz-eLfa-c7be-IiyB-GaHL26' not found.
removing the cache fixes the issue.
lvmid/OwVp3J-KH9N-RcXl-Fh3J-ZEiZ-egg4-JRffI3/7Dieap-dj1i-dHiz-eLfa-c7be-IiyB-GaHL26 is my boot lvm partition which is a regular uncached linear partition.
